Service Manual Instructions for the Canon-imageRUNNER-4570 E000 0001 Error Code

E000 0001
Description :
The temperature of the fixing assembly is abnormally high.

Causes :
While startup control is under way, the reading of the main thermistor is less than 30 deg C continuously for 200 msec or more 1 sec after the start of power supply.
While startup control is under way, the reading of the main thermistor is less than 70 deg C continuously for 200 msec or more 2 sec after the start of power supply.
While startup control is under way, the reading of the main thermistor is less than 120 deg C continuously for 200 msec 6 sec after the start of power supply.
The startup control does not end 30 sec after the start of power supply.

Solutions :
Reset the condition in service mode: COPIER>FUNCTION>CLEAR> ERR.
Replace the main thermistor.
Replace the DC controller PCB.
